Factors Affecting Cost

  • Soil Type: The type of soil in your yard can significantly affect trenching costs. Rocky or clay-heavy soils are more challenging to dig through.
  • Depth and Width of Trench: Deeper and wider trenches require more labor and time, increasing the overall cost.
  • Length of Trench: The longer the trench, the more materials and labor will be needed, which can drive up costs.
  • Accessibility: Hard-to-reach areas or yards with limited access may require specialized equipment, adding to the expense.
  • Permits and Regulations: Local permits and regulations in Bozeman, MT can add to the cost, depending on the scope of the project.
  • Labor Rates: The cost of labor can vary, but in Bozeman, MT, expect to pay a premium for skilled workers.
  • Equipment Rental: If specialized equipment is needed, rental fees will add to the overall cost of the project.
  • Time of Year: Seasonal demand can affect pricing, with peak times potentially costing more.

Average Costs for Common Tasks

Task Average Cost (Bozeman, MT)
Irrigation System Installation $1,500 - $3,000
Utility Line Installation $1,200 - $2,500
Drainage System Installation $1,000 - $2,200
Foundation Trenching $2,000 - $4,000
Cable or Internet Line Trenching $800 - $1,500
Basic Trenching (per linear foot) $10 - $20
